As someone who has been towing trailers for many years, I can attest to the fact that a trailer brake hydraulic actuator is an essential component for safe and efficient towing. This device is responsible for controlling the brakes on a trailer, allowing it to stop smoothly and quickly in synchronization with the vehicle. Without a properly functioning actuator, towing can become a dangerous and stressful experience.

One of the main reasons why a trailer brake hydraulic actuator is necessary is for safety purposes. When towing heavy loads, it is crucial to have reliable braking capabilities in order to prevent accidents. The actuator ensures that the trailer’s brakes are activated at the same time as the vehicle’s brakes, providing better control and stopping power. This is especially important when driving on steep inclines or in emergency situations.

Moreover, having a hydraulic actuator also reduces wear and tear on both the vehicle and trailer’s brakes. When towing without an actuator, the vehicle’s brakes bear most of the weight and pressure from stopping both itself and the trailer. This can lead to premature wear and even brake failure over time. With a hydraulic actuator, the braking force is distributed evenly between both vehicles, prolonging the lifespan of their respective brakes.

Understanding the Basics

The first step in buying a trailer brake hydraulic actuator is to understand its basic functioning. The actuator is responsible for converting the pressure from your vehicle’s braking system into hydraulic pressure, which then activates the brakes on your trailer. It also has a built-in electric reverse lockout feature that prevents the brakes from engaging when backing up. This mechanism is crucial for safe towing and should be carefully considered while making a purchase.

Type of Actuators

There are two types of trailer brake hydraulic actuators – surge and electric-over-hydraulic (EOH). Surge actuators use the momentum of your vehicle to activate the brakes on your trailer, making them suitable for lighter trailers. On the other hand, EOH actuators use an electric motor to generate hydraulic pressure, making them more suitable for heavier trailers. Consider the weight and size of your trailer while choosing between these two types.

Quality and Durability

A high-quality trailer brake hydraulic actuator should be made from corrosion-resistant materials such as stainless steel or aluminum. It should also have a robust construction to withstand heavy loads and rough terrain. Make sure to check reviews or ask for recommendations from fellow travelers before making a purchase.

Safety Features

The safety features of a trailer brake hydraulic actuator play a significant role in ensuring safe towing. Look for features like emergency breakaway kits, which automatically engage the brakes on your trailer if it becomes disconnected from your vehicle. Another essential safety feature is an adjustable channel bracket that allows you to adjust the height of your coupler according to different vehicles.
